S.J.Res. 28 (110th)
A joint resolution disapproving the rule submitted by the Federal Communications Commission with respect to broadcast media ownership.

Summary
Disapproves the rule submitted by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) and received by Congress on February 22, 2008, relating to broadcast media ownership.
